How they compare
Malaysia currently reports 0.1068 against 0.0864 in Cameroon, a difference of 0.0204.
That makes Malaysia's figure about 1.2 times Cameroon's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 62 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Cameroon ahead.
Cameroon ranks 113th and Malaysia ranks 110th of 187 countries.
Cameroon has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cameroon | Malaysia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 0.4589 | 0.0111 | 0.4478 | Cameroon |
| 1970s | 0.447 | 0.01 | 0.437 | Cameroon |
| 1980s | 0.097 | 0.013 | 0.084 | Cameroon |
| 1990s | 0.075 | 0.027 | 0.048 | Cameroon |
| 2000s | 0.0972 | 0.0126 | 0.0846 | Cameroon |
| 2010s | 0.102 | 0.0291 | 0.0729 | Cameroon |
| 2020s | 0.0908 | 0.0624 | 0.0284 | Cameroon |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
